Why Choose Opa Locka Airport?
Opa Locka Airport, officially known as Miami-Opa Locka Executive Airport, is a preferred destination for private jet travelers. Situated just 11 miles north of downtown Miami, it offers convenience and exclusivity. With less congestion compared to Miami International, it’s an ideal choice for those seeking efficiency.

What to Expect Upon Arrival
Arriving at Opa Locka Airport is a seamless experience. The airport has several Fixed Base Operators (FBOs) offering a range of services. From refueling and maintenance to luxury lounges and ground transportation, everything is at your fingertips.
